Output 8e5398d9dc59b4ec1f7e731421b9c72f09a8b5714596f2d7b3d50f70135f7471: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d2654fc941d1593074d0022bed726540a99c4e OP_EQUAL
address
3DtbqcLdJhjgdxdvUZPA3jk8CzA7MkwmsA
transaction
8e5398d9dc59b4ec1f7e731421b9c72f09a8b5714596f2d7b3d50f70135f7471
spent
true